Output 661fd94fa28cdde30cdc7e23cb12bebd57601086cbe7aa095b2d64e0802c694c:3

value
174557480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 feaf5929ad4e380d40d5a2c1cbd60cc96a4c174c OP_EQUALVERIFY OP_CHECKSIG
address
1QDeh8zkfG9xAaFoA66Bqwbfa9Famu1E7g
transaction
661fd94fa28cdde30cdc7e23cb12bebd57601086cbe7aa095b2d64e0802c694c
spent
true